Abstract
Embodiments of SiC devices and corresponding methods of manufacture are provided. In some embodiments, the SiC device has shielding regions at the bottom of some gate trenches and non-linear junctions formed with the SiC material at the bottom of other gate trenches. In other embodiments, the SiC device has the shielding regions at the bottom of the gate trenches and arranged in rows which run in a direction transverse to a lengthwise extension of the trenches. In still other embodiments, the SiC device has the shielding regions and the non-linear junctions, and wherein the shielding regions are arranged in rows which run in a direction transverse to a lengthwise extension of the trenches.
